RSV in Infants: A Critical Early Challenge
Respiratory syncytial virus (RSV) is a common wintertime pathogen that most healthy adults weather with mild cold-like symptoms. For infants, especially those under six months, RSV can lead to bronchiolitis and pneumonia, sometimes necessitating hospital care. While vaccination strategies for other age groups exist, protecting newborns and very young babies requires targeted approaches. Recent advances in monoclonal antibody (mAb) therapy have provided a powerful tool to shield the most vulnerable infants from RSV during the peak season.
What Are Monoclonal Antibodies and How Do They Help?
Monoclonal antibodies are lab-made proteins designed to mimic the body’s natural defenses. For RSV prevention, a specific long-acting mAb binds to the virus’s fusion protein, preventing RSV from entering cells and replicating. Because these antibodies circulate in the infant’s bloodstream after a single dose, they offer durable protection throughout the RSV season, reducing the risk of severe disease and hospitalization.
Key Prophylaxis: A Single Dose for Seasonal Protection
One leading monoclonal antibody used for RSV prevention in infants provides protection for several months with a single intramuscular injection. This is especially important for infants who are born preterm, have congenital heart disease, or other conditions that heighten the risk of RSV complications. The dosing schedule is typically aligned with the infant’s age and the anticipated RSV season, making timing crucial for optimal protection.
Who Stands to Benefit?
Infants at highest risk include:
– Preterm babies, particularly those born before 37 weeks gestation
– Babies with chronic lung disease or certain heart defects
– Very young infants in communities with high RSV circulation
However, vaccination strategies for other groups, including pregnant people and older adults, are being explored to broaden protection across populations. For newborns, the monoclonal antibody approach offers a targeted shield during the vulnerable first months of life.
How Safe Is Monoclonal Antibody Prophylaxis?
Clinical studies and real-world use have demonstrated a favorable safety profile for these antibodies when administered to infants. Commonly reported side effects are mild and transient, such as redness at the injection site or low-grade fever. As with any medical intervention, parents should consult pediatricians to discuss eligibility, timing, and any potential contraindications based on the infant’s health history.

Looking Ahead: A Complement to Other Preventive Measures
Monoclonal antibodies are part of a broader strategy to reduce RSV burden among infants. While hand hygiene, avoiding exposure during peak season, and keeping up with routine pediatric visits remain essential, targeted prophylaxis with monoclonal antibodies adds a crucial layer of defense for the youngest and most vulnerable children.
